Analyzing the sold production of agricultural and forestry machinery in the Netherlands from 2013 to 2023 reveals a highly volatile trend. The value in 2023 stands at 205.49 thousand items. High fluctuations are evident, with notable peaks in 2016, 2019, and 2022, and significant drops in years like 2014 and 2021. The previous two years showed substantial recovery with a 12.53% year-on-year increase in 2023. The CAGR over the past five years equates to a modest 4.75% growth.
Future projections indicate a steady upward trend with the sold production expected to reach 232.91 thousand items by 2028. The five-year forecasted CAGR stands at 1.99%, suggesting a slower but positive growth trajectory.
